9. Psychographic Segmentation Strategies
Demographic data alone doesn't capture customer motivations. Psychographic segmentation—considering values, interests, and lifestyles—enables deeper personalization. Implementing psychographic segmentation strategies enhances message resonance and engagement.

2. Behavioral Triggers for Re-Engagement
Many email campaigns miss the right timing to reconnect with disengaged users. Behavioral triggers, such as cart abandonment or inactivity, automate timely responses. Learn how behavioral triggers can boost re-engagement and keep your audience interested.
